<p>At nineteen, Layla had two choices: marry a man she despised, or disappear into the night with nothing but a Quran, two dresses, and the courage to build a life no one had given her permission to want.</p><p>Born in a remote Arab village where a woman's future is decided before she learns to want one, Layla grows up between clay ovens and borrowed dreams, until the night her brother's ultimatum makes the choice for her. <b>Forced into an arranged marriage</b> she never agreed to, she does the unthinkable: she runs.</p><p>What follows is a story of two rebellious women navigating a world that was never built for them. Crossing ravines, reinventing identities, and learning that <b>freedom in the Arab world</b> is not a destination but a daily decision - Layla and her cousin Amira fight not just to <b>escape</b>, but to become.</p><p>From a remote village to the capital city, from poverty to self-made wealth, from silence to a voice that can finally say no - <b>Layla the Rebel</b> is a <b>powerful women's fiction</b> novel that asks: what does a woman owe the family that tried to own her?</p><p>Perfect for every book club searching for <b>international literary fiction</b> that centers a <b>strong female protagonist</b> who refuses to be a decision made by someone else.</p><p>A debut novel of <b>female empowerment</b>, cultural identity, and the price of choosing yourself, set against the rich, rarely seen landscape of the Arab world.</p>
